     Section 8.  Subsections (4) and (5) are added to section

8

202.29, Florida Statutes, to read:

9

     202.29  Bad debts.--

10

     (4) A taxpayer may report the credit for bad debt allowed

11

under this section by netting such credit against the tax due to

12

the state pursuant to s. 202.12 or to a local jurisdiction

13

pursuant to s. 202.19, but such netting may not reduce the amount

14

due to the state or to any local jurisdiction below zero.

15

     (5) For purposes of determining the amount of bad debt that

16

is attributable to the state or to a local jurisdiction, a

17

taxpayer may employ a proportionate allocation method based on

18

current gross taxes due or another reasonable allocation method

19

approved by the department.

20

     Section 9. The amendments made by this act to s. 202.29,

21

Florida Statutes, shall be effective as if originally enacted in

22

chapter 2000-260, Laws of Florida; however, the retroactive

23

application of such section is remedial in nature, does not

24

create a right to a refund, and does not require a refund by any

25

governmental entity of any tax, penalty, or interest remitted to

26

the Department of Revenue before July 1, 2008.
